Government—grants programs
(Question No 810)

Mrs Dunne asked the Attorney-General, upon notice, on 24 March 2010:

(1) How many grants programs are administered by each agency within the Department of Justice and Community Safety, including ACT Courts and the Director of Public Prosecutions.

(2) What is the cost of administering each grants program.

(3) What is the total value of grants paid during 1 July to 31 December 2009.

Mr Corbell: The answer to the member’s question is as follows:

1) The Department has provided one grant in 2009-10.

2) The cost of administering this grant program is minimal.

3) The total value of the grant payment during 1 July to 31 December 2009 was $20,000. In addition, the Department also provides a number of community organisations with service payments.
